Louise Blezzard – Founder & CEO
Our founder, Louise, is recognised as a transformational change leader with more than a decade’s experience of working in the health and social care sector.
With a long-standing passion for delivering exceptional care, Louise benefits from a unique clinical, compliance and commercial background.
Her extensive experience encompasses time as a CQC inspector as well as being Group Director of Wellbeing & Membership at Loveday, meaning she has in-depth experience of managing the application of high-quality care.
A natural people person with strong interpersonal skills, Louise’s empathetic nature has helped shape Venelle’s core person-centric values.
-
Louise’s capabilities centre on business process improvement, change management, good clinical practice (GCP), regulatory compliance, and operational delivery.
Her career in the healthcare sector began with a nursing degree, which saw her work as a nurse and ward sister in the NHS before Louise seized the opportunity to transition into a care management role. Operating as a registered manager and an operational manager, Louise then moved on to work directly for the CQC as an inspector, something that gave her a unique and wide-ranging insight into the workings of well-run homes.
Wanting to get back into a care management role full time, Louise joined leading luxury care group Loveday as a general manager before stepping up to the senior leadership team as Group Director of Wellbeing and Membership.
Her extensive practical experience has been supplemented by additional academic rigour in the form of a Master's degree in Healthcare Management from the University of Surrey – with Louise applying high level theory to her day-to-day, something that’s helped her achieve ratings of Outstanding across four of her last five CQC assessments.

Kelly Morris – Registered Manager and Director of Care Operations
With more than 20 years’ experience in care, including eighteen spent leading home care services, Kelly has a wealth of expertise in delivering outstanding, compassionate, person-centred care.
Her experience incorporates older care and dementia care, as well as care and support around long-term conditions, physical disabilities, learning disabilities, spinal injuries, end of life care and more – meaning she’s able to support people with a broad range of needs.
A resident of South West London, Kelly has experience of delivering exceptional care throughout the capital.
-
A registered manager and nominated individual with the CQC, Kelly is fully qualified in Leadership and Management in Health and Social Care and is a specialist trainer when it comes to End of Life Care (Gold Standard Framework), Safeguarding and Medication.
Previous roles have seen her jointly chair monthly safeguarding panels with local authority Safeguarding Leads, while’s she’s also spent time coordinating nursing recruitment for a 35 strong group of care homes, nationwide.
In addition, Kelly has worked as the area manager for homecare branches spanning several London boroughs, which included the establishment, CQC registration and development of new branches.
From here, Kelly Progressed to Homecare Operations Director, with full responsibility for services supporting 230 adults, delivering 6,500 hours of care each week – leading a team of 270 carers, and 12 Operational staff.
Consistent CQC ratings have been her career hallmark, with her care provision rated as outstanding when it comes to being assessed under well-led.
Here at Venelle, Kelly is putting this extensive experience in practice as we grow and enhance our offering.
